H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D LUCKNOW CRIMINAL MISC. BAIL APPLICATION No. - 2243 of 2026 Imran @ Najjar .....Applicant(s) Versus State Of U.P. Thru. Prin. Secy. Home Deptt. Civil Sectt. Lko. .....Opposite Party(s) Counsel for Applicant(s) : Kailash Nath Mishra, Rahul Mishra Counsel for Opposite Party(s): G.A. Court No. - 28 HON'BLE RAJEEV BHARTI, J. 1.Heard learned counsel for the applicant, learned Additional Government Advocate for the State and perused the record. 2.Learned counsel for the applicant submits that the applicant is not named in the first information report. No incriminating material has been recovered from the possession of the applicant. The applicant was not arrested from the spot; rather he was arrested from his cousin's house. The alleged recovery of knife, chopping block etc on the pointing out of the applicant and the co-accused Kaleem is false and concocted. In fact, as submitted above, nothing has been recovered from the applicant.
